Wolverine rogues discussion thread dead characters spoliers not tagged

Though many of you might not care, I found this kinda of odd and interesting.

Many of Wolverine rogues just while back an elimination tournaments of sorts.

Sabre-tooth is dead, Omega Red is Dead, Wild child is Dead, Cyber is Dead.

That is a good chunk of his rouges gone.

Now you have Mister X and Gorgon being brought back, but they not longer his villains. Deathstrike is now more of an X-men villain then anything. Silver Samuria really not longer a rouge of he his more of an reluctant ally. Rough-House and Bloodscream no longer fight him as well.


With all of his rouges seemly gone, with Romulas being the only one left and sorta his son. Do people think they try and bring the dead ones back? Or will they just give him a hole new set of rouges. What are everyones thoughts? Is this marvels new thing to revamp the rouges of popular characters? If they do bring in new characters which ones do you believe they be? Or which characters living or dead do you think they will bring back to be regular rouge of Wolverines again?
